Ingredients

Fish Broth, Mackerel, Tuna Fillet, Carrageenan, Potato Starch, Natural Fish Flavor, Guar Gum

Fish Broth

Fish broth is a liquid made from simmering fish in water. It is a source of hydration and can add flavor to the food. It is generally safe for cats, but be cautious if your cat has a fish allergy.

Mackerel

Mackerel is a type of fish that is rich in omega-3 fatty acids, which can benefit a cat's skin and coat health. It is a good source of protein and essential nutrients. However, some cats may be allergic to fish.

Tuna Fillet

Tuna fillet is a popular fish choice for cats due to its strong flavor. It is high in protein and omega-3 fatty acids. Tuna should be fed in moderation as it can lead to mercury poisoning if consumed in large quantities.

Carrageenan

Carrageenan is a common additive in wet cat food that helps to thicken and stabilize the product. It is derived from seaweed and is generally considered safe for cats, but some studies suggest it may cause inflammation in the digestive tract.

Potato Starch

Potato starch is a carbohydrate that is used as a thickening agent in wet cat food. It is generally well-tolerated by cats, but excessive consumption may lead to weight gain.

Natural Fish Flavor

Natural fish flavor is added to enhance the taste of the food. It is generally safe for cats, but be cautious if your cat has a fish allergy.

Guar Gum

Guar gum is a thickening agent derived from guar beans. It helps to create a smooth texture in wet cat food. It is generally safe for cats, but some cats may have difficulty digesting it.


Guaranteed Analysis

Crude Protein 9.0% min
Crude Fat 0.1% min
Crude Fiber 2.0 % max
Moisture 94.0% max

Crude Protein

Crude protein is essential for cats as it helps in muscle growth and maintenance. A minimum of 9.0% is considered adequate for a wet cat food.

Crude Fat

Crude fat is a concentrated source of energy for cats. A minimum of 0.1% is very low and may not provide sufficient energy for cats.

Crude Fiber

Crude fiber aids in digestion and helps prevent hairballs. A maximum of 2.0% is within the acceptable range for wet cat food.

Moisture

Moisture content is important for hydration in cats. A maximum of 94.0% ensures that the food is moist and appealing to cats.
